Composition History

2786 - 2821

17th Lyran Regulars (Regiment/Green/Reliable) [1]

Note: In 2821 the medium-weight command was reduced to 40 percent of its strength and was deployed on Dijonne. [1]

2830

17th Lyran Regulars (Regiment/Green/Reliable) [2]

Note: At this point in time the medium-weight unit was stationed on Dijonne with an operational readiness of 87 percent. [2] The unit was destroyed during the war.[2]
